Not everyone is happy with the new mask order.

Waay'31 max cohan caught up with people in limestone county to hear their thoughts about it.

Today on the streets of athens, many people already were wearing masks.

And with governor ivey's mandatory mask order set to take effect at 5 pm thursday -- some are saying it's absolutely the right thing for the state.

"everyone should do that.

I mean, it's the safe way to be, especially with older people."

Deborah davis set masks up on the window mannequins of her daughters athens store wednesday.

She says its a way to let people know the store is selling masks for kids.

"this is a part of life now, our lives are different and we've sold a lot today, for small children and 10 and 12 year olds.

Davis says there was a rush after the order was announced today.

The store usually sells about 5 masks a day -- today they sold more than 30.

Today many in athens declined to talk on camera about the order, but some said they are not in favor of it-- questioning the effectiveness of masks.

"everybody to their own opinion, but safety is the main concern now."

Over at the sportsplex, darvin poole -- a former alabamian now living in georgia says people should follow the orders they're given.

"anything we can do to protect is a good thing, and if that's what your governor wants, i think that's what we oughta do."

Poole is in town visiting family and said nothing, including a mask order, could stop him from seeing them.

"you know, they're high on the priority so whatever i have to do, i'm gonna do."

Reporting in athens, max cohan, waay 31 news.

The order requires people to wear masks in public when within six feet of people from another household.
